Not daughter Sara, Saif to launch a fresh face with his new production banner Black Knight Films

Saif Ali Khan's and Dinesh Vijan's banner Illuminati Films, had produced some interesting films like Love Aaj Kal (2009), Cocktail (2012) and Go Goa Gone (2013). Later, Dinesh set up his own production house and we now Saif is all set to take a similar route. The actor has launched his production banner, called Black Knight Films.

A source revealed to a leading daily, "Saif had been planning to set up his own banner and start producing films again. He has the business and creative acumen for it and was looking to get an entire team in place before the big announcement.” The actor has joined hands with long-time friend Jay Shewakramani for Black Knight Films and their first project together is likely to be Filmistaan director Nitin Kakkar’s next, tentatively titled Jawaani Jaaneman.

Meanwhile, it is interesting to note that Saif's daughter Sara Ali Khan was also speculated to be a part of Nitin's upcoming family comedy. But after Saif quashed the rumours, it is now learned that he will be launching a fresh face with his upcoming production venture. "There was speculation about Sara working with her father in the film directed by Nitin, but things didn’t work out. Now, the makers will cast a fresh face. Saif and Jay are personally looking into the casting as the actor believes that an author-backed role like this is perfect for a debutante," the daily quoted an insider as saying.

Although Saif is yet to confirm the news, his partner Jay talked revealed about the development to the daily and said, "When I ventured out from Tips, the first director I approached was Nitin Kakkar. Around that time, I was developing the script of Jawaani Jaaneman; I narrated it to Nitin who loved it and that’s how it all fell in place.”

It looks like Saif’s new production house will start work from March 2019 after the Baazaar actor fulfills his prior professional commitments.
